Found in hill streams to peat (Ref. 57235). Recorded from small streams and flooded forest (Ref. 56749). Solitary and with its cryptic coloration, strongly resembles a piece of dead leaf (Ref. 85309). Feeds on small fishes and crustaceans (Ref. 56749).
